Overview

Kyle Hershey is a corporate attorney who represents both public and private companies, including private equity funds, in mergers and acquisitions, dispositions, co-investments, joint ventures and other general corporate matters. He also represents insureds and underwriters in connection with transactional risk products, including the issuances of representations and warranties insurance policies.

During law school, Mr. Hershey was a member of the University of Miami International and Comparative Law Review.
